Group 1 - The Ministry of Industry and Information Technology and the National Health Commission of China have launched a notice to collect innovative applications of biological manufacturing technologies in the food processing sector, focusing on areas such as food raw materials, food additives, and food and beverage manufacturing [1] - The application directions should align with the goal of building a diversified food supply system and have significant promotional value for industry development, referencing safety evaluation requirements for genetically modified microorganisms [1] - Specific conditions for the applications include: products must be developed domestically and have entered small-scale trial production or mass production; products must have sufficient research results proving their safety or have been approved in other countries for food processing; and products must meet the criteria for "three new foods" in China but have not yet been approved [1] Group 2 - Huazhong Securities has released a research report indicating that frontier research in life sciences remains active, with a global biotechnology revolution accelerating its integration into economic and social development, providing new solutions for major challenges such as health, climate change, resource security, and food security [2] - The report suggests that the biological economy is emerging as a trillion-dollar sector, highlighting the potential for significant investment opportunities in this field [2]

Summary of Key Points Core Viewpoint - In the first half of the year, China conducted 485 recalls of defective consumer products, involving approximately 2.93 million items, marking a year-on-year increase of 22.17% in the number of recalls and 3.61% in the number of items recalled [1] Group 1: Recall Statistics - A total of 485 defective consumer product recalls were conducted in China from January to June, involving 2.93 million items [1] - The cumulative number of defective product recalls reached 6,470, involving a total of 108 million items as of June 30 [1] Group 2: Recall Categories - The largest category of recalls was electronic and electrical products, with 1.30 million items recalled, accounting for 44.56% of the total recalls [1] - Food-related product recalls totaled 945,500 items, representing 32.3% of the total [1] - Children's products accounted for 348,700 items recalled, making up 11.91% of the total [1]

Core Viewpoint - The State Administration for Market Regulation (SAMR) will conduct national quality supervision and random inspections on 164 types of products in 2025, focusing on ensuring product safety and quality across various sectors [1] Group 1: Inspection Scope and Methodology - SAMR will employ a dual-random approach to select enterprises for inspection and match them with sampling inspection institutions [1] - A total of over 16,000 batches of samples will be collected from production, circulation, and online sales, covering eight key areas including electronics, agricultural materials, construction materials, and food-related products [1] Group 2: Focus Areas for 2025 - Children's products will remain a key focus for inspections this year [1] - The inspection intensity for products sold through live streaming and online sales will significantly increase, with the number of batches inspected rising by 70% compared to 2024 [1] - The inspection batches for products such as power banks and electric bicycles will also see a substantial increase [1] Group 3: Emerging Industries - To support the rapid development of emerging industries, electric vehicle charging stations, power batteries, drones, and photovoltaic components will be included in the inspection scope [1]
